This episode discusses the COAST stage of business, emphasizing the importance of coasting as a strategic phase for business owners, particularly during personal life events.
Welcome to the Pursuing Private Practice podcast! Join Jennifer McGurk, CEO of Pursuing Private Practice, and team member Courtney Vickery, CEO of Declet Designs, to talk about the COAST stage of business. Join them to discuss the importance of coasting as a business owner, how it can be a strategic and intentional phase, and the benefits it brings to personal and professional life. When you're a business owner, the need to COAST can come up at any time, sometimes planned, and sometimes unplanned. Whether you think you'll be coasting anytime soon or not, this episode will leave you feeling confident when it's your time to COAST. COAST Stage of Business: Coasting is defined as an intentional phase in business, often necessary during personal life events. Boundaries and Self-Care in the COAST Stage: Emphasizes the importance of evolving boundaries and prioritizing self-care during coasting. Personal Development and Self-Understanding: Business ownership offers opportunities for personal growth and understanding one's strengths and weaknesses. Saying No and Identity as a Business Owner: Discusses the power of saying no and balancing personal identity with business responsibilities…
